The Police Officer position is responsible for deterring illegal activities, protecting and preserving the safety and security of individuals, buildings, and neighborhoods, and providing customer service and responding to calls for service. The incumbent must possess a valid Colorado P.O.S.T. certification, be at least 21 years of age, and have a valid Colorado driver's license with a safe driving record.
